Land swap possible
In a major land swap, Dartmouth may acquire Hanover High School and its fields, which occupy a prime site adjacent the College’s athletic complex, The Dartmouth reports.
New sports facilities
New sports facilities stand behind Thompson Arena: Scully-Fahey Field, an artificial turf field with bleachers seating 1,500, and the Alexis Boss Tennis Center and Gordon Pavilion.

McLane Lodge
The Skiway has replaced the Brundage Lodge with the new McLane Lodge.
[Update 07.20.2005: Banwell Architects, designers of the Boathouse, designed the McLane Lodge.]

Rugby Clubhouse
The Rugby Club is planning the Corey Ford Rugby Clubhouse, designed by Randall Mudge, the school announced.

Lebanon Street building
The school and town are building a parking garage and commercial building on Lebanon Street behind the Hop, The Dartmouth reports.
Grasse Road
Dartmouth plans to add 45 faculty housing units to the 32 existing in its Grasse Road development, The Dartmouth reports.

Wilder addition and others
Wilder is getting a tower and a new rear facade in Centerbrook Architects’ Science Center Addition, the Facilities Planning Office announced.
Rauner Special Collections Library in Webster Hall by VSBA is now finished, the library announced.
McCulloch Hall
The FPO has other projects underway including a fourth New Dorm, called McCulloch Hall and designed by Atkin, Olshin, Lawson-Bell and ready for Fall 2000, the school announced.
